91321 vs 91320: cost of living, income and home prices

ZIP 91321 (California) has a median household income of $84,503 and a typical home value of $603,300. ZIP 91320 (California) sits at $143,873 and $884,500.

Source: U.S. Census Bureau, American Community Survey (5-year). Latest observation ACS 2022.

Measure9132191320
Median household income$84,503$143,873
Median home value$603,300$884,500
Median gross rent$1,972$2,651
Median age33.9 yrs42.9 yrs
Homeownership rate59.4%75.7%
Bachelor's degree or higher19.3%30.5%

Methodology

Both columns use ZIP Code Tabulation Area estimates from the same Census release, so the comparison is like for like.

We only publish comparisons where both areas have at least 5,000 residents, which keeps the margin of error usable.

Sources: U.S. Census Bureau, American Community Survey (5-year). American Community Survey 5-year estimates, 2022.
